What is PRP?
Platelet-Rich Plasma is a concentrated source of autologous platelets found in your own blood. These platelets are biological "first responders" packed with growth factors and cytokines. When isolated and re-injected into targeted areas, they act as a signal to your cells to jumpstart tissue repair, collagen production, and vascular growth.

Facial Rejuvenation: The Natural Alternative to Fillers
While dermal fillers are excellent for adding immediate structural volume, they don’t always improve the quality of the skin itself. PRP is a restorative treatment that improves the skin’s architecture.
